Regular price
$1,943.29
On Sale from $1,494.84
Regular price
$1,349.21
On Sale from $1,037.85
Regular price
$1,597.45
On Sale from $1,228.81
Regular price
$2,255.89
On Sale from $1,735.30
Regular price
$1,254.84
On Sale from $965.26
Regular price
$2,566.19
On Sale from $1,973.99
Regular price
$2,464.89
On Sale from $1,896.07
Regular price
$2,390.82
On Sale from $1,839.09
Regular price
$2,213.65
On Sale from $1,702.81
Regular price
$927.23
On Sale from $713.25
Regular price
$1,674.14
On Sale from $1,287.80
Regular price
$1,602.86
On Sale from $1,232.97